    I called shutterfly and told them that I really loved their STD however it was alot more $$ than vistaprint. The lovely respresentative said wait a min and placed me on hold. Then she updated my cart to give me 25 free prints of the STD. In addition they had a coupon for free shipping and they also had a $15 off coupon for new customers so my save the dates from SHUTTERFLY ended up costing me $38 including tax and shipping for 55 prints. YEAH!! It never hurts to ask for a discount!!
